Uniform stationary exclusion and non-circular minus-parameter selection #

The key input from source Lemma 10.27 is kept as an adjacent-value comparison, not as the desired scalar inequality. Division by the positive s * R s and the stationary equation give (10.46), namely ξ(s)-c-2/s = R(s-1)/(sR(s)) ≥ 1-K/s. Consequently the cutoff below depends on the comparison constants (and hence on R) but not on c.

Source Lemma 10.27 in the precise comparison form used here. The adjoint argument in the source produces this estimate for R; no scalar kernel bound, stationary exclusion, or conclusion of (10.56) is stored in this packet.
